mratsim avatar mratsim commented on June 1, 2024

For distributed computing, the SparseSet introduced in #15 is too memory hungry.

It can be replaced by succinct data structure. Constant-time rank support for succinct data structure (which requires a bit of overhead over the bitset) is the subject of in-depth research.
